As you know, Super Mario Bros. Crossover WAS a Flash game that, while mostly focused on Super Mario Bros., featured characters from The Legend of Zelda, Metroid, Mega Man, Castlevania, Ninja Gaiden, Blaster Master, and Contra. But, no thanks to Adobe killing Flash on January 1st of 2021, the game is just dead in the water, as when you try to use the game's preloader in a non-browser Flash player, it crashes after going to a black screen (after the initial loading screen, that is). I hate to say it, but other than a sprite sheet of Mega Man and a page of unused sprites on TCRF, Super Mario Bros. Crossover was doomed to die after its final 3.1.21 version released in 2013. Adobe released something called the "Flash Content Debugger" alongside each version of Flash that had a standalone player included (And by standalone I mean a literal single file that requires no installation/registry access): This is what I've always used to play Flash games, and it works perfectly under Wine if you run Linux as well.

Not sure how hard it is to find on Adobe's actual site these days, but somebody has uploaded a copy of just the player to the Internet Archive, here:
